Output 74f45b0b85d48e09c89c3265bc0f440f6dc77832d4f90c317946844d44ea23e4:1

value
997996956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ed3041d0b2b8a6aec54dc3b245a7763c2d2c5e3c68983a8ac7ae0b884e793a7
address
tb1pdmfsg8gt9w9x4mz5msajgknhv0pd930rc6yc829v0tst3p88jwns82rnxa
transaction
74f45b0b85d48e09c89c3265bc0f440f6dc77832d4f90c317946844d44ea23e4
confirmations
19756
spent
true